How does a session work?
Each session begins with a brief conversation to understand your goals and general state of wellbeing. This is followed by a reading using the SCIO device and, based on the analysis, frequency-guided rebalancing. The session is gentle, painless and requires no special preparation. At the end, the therapist shares their observations and, where appropriate, suggests suitable follow-up care.
Is it safe? Are there any contraindications?
SCIO Biofeedback technology is suitable for adults and children and is a non-invasive, painless method that does not involve the use of medication. As a precaution, its use is not recommended for people with pacemakers or other implantable electronic devices, during pregnancy, or for people with epilepsy, unless otherwise advised by their doctor.

How long does a session last?
A typical session lasts around 45 to 60 minutes, including the initial discussion, the reading using the equipment, and the sharing of observations at the end. The duration may vary depending on each person’s objectives.
How many sessions are needed?
It depends on the individual and their wellbeing goals. Many people opt for regular sessions; the therapist will help you decide on the most suitable frequency for you during your first session.
Can children do biofeedback?
Yes. SCIO technology is suitable for adults and children, provided they are accompanied by a parent or guardian and have undergone a prior assessment.
Are there any contraindications to biofeedback?
As a precaution, this treatment is not recommended for people with pacemakers or other implantable electronic devices, during pregnancy, or for people with epilepsy, unless otherwise advised by your doctor. If you have any doubts, please let us know before booking an appointment.
Do I need to do any preparation beforehand?
No special preparation is required. We simply recommend that you arrive well-rested, well-hydrated and wearing comfortable clothing.
